That part is still manual in every warehouse because it’s really hard for robots to do, because there are millions of different products and objects and all of them are different sizes, shapes, weights, textures, stiffness, etc. When you fulfill an online order, you have to pick the items and pack them into a box. And if you look at what those people are actually doing, they’re doing the picking and packing step – the last manual fulfillment task. If you look at the best Amazon warehouse in the world today, it has a lot of automation but it’s still designed around people: what people can do, where people can go, what’s safe, productive, ergonomic for people. Nimble is creating intelligent robots, and we’re using those robots to reimagine and reinvent e-commerce fulfillment. Kalouche was recently named one of Forbes 30 under 30 in manufacturing and industry for 2021.įor those who don’t know, what does Nimble Robotics do? They already have fleets of robots out in the real world, picking millions of products for some of the world’s largest retailers. Nimble is reinventing fulfillment with intelligent robots that can pick and pack anything. Kalouche eventually paused his academic work to found Nimble Robotics. Later that year, he began working towards a PhD in Robotics at Stanford University. Kalouche went on to earn his master’s in robotics from Carnegie Mellon in 2016. He also minored in entrepreneurship and innovation. As an undergraduate, Kalouche was the recipient of Ohio State’s Outstanding Undergraduate Research Award and the first place winner of the Denman Undergraduate Research Forum. Nimble Robotics founder and CEO Simon Kalouche earned his bachelor’s with honors in mechanical engineering from The Ohio State University in 2014.
